Avatar billede andersasp Nybegynder
29. januar 2009 - 10:23 Der er 1 kommentar og
1 løsning

MYSQL sql order by

Hejsa,

Jeg har et udtræk hvor jeg sorterer data udfra en Varchar database felt.. Alle data ligger dog i TAL format, og af denne grund sorterer den ikke korrekt..

Er det muligt at lave Varchar værdien om til numerisk i SQL sætningen, uden at skulle ændre feltet i databasen??

På forhånd tak!
Avatar billede langthjem Nybegynder
03. februar 2009 - 10:38 #1
Prøv at bruge noget i retning af: ORDER BY CAST(feltnavn AS INT)
Jeg har ikke afprøvet det, men i teorien burde det virke.
Avatar billede Slettet bruger
07. marts 2009 - 15:51 #2
hvad med: order by CInt(feltnavn)

eller CLng, CSng, CDbl... alt efter hvilken type tal du benytter.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ester